To diagnose noisy plumbing, it is very important to establish initial whether the undesirable audios take place on the system's inlet side-in various other words, when water is transformed on-or on the drainpipe side. Sounds on the inlet side have varied causes: too much water stress, used valve and tap components, incorrectly linked pumps or other devices, inaccurately put pipe bolts, as well as plumbing runs including way too many limited bends or other constraints. Sounds on the drainpipe side generally stem from bad area or, as with some inlet side noise, a format containing tight bends.
Hissing
Hissing noise that takes place when a tap is opened slightly typically signals extreme water stress. Consult your neighborhood public utility if you suspect this problem; it will be able to tell you the water pressure in your area as well as can set up a pressurereducing valve on the incoming water system pipeline if required.
Thudding
Thudding sound, often accompanied by shivering pipes, when a tap or appliance shutoff is switched off is a problem called water hammer. The noise and vibration are caused by the reverberating wave of pressure in the water, which all of a sudden has no place to go. In some cases opening a valve that releases water promptly right into a section of piping including a restriction, elbow, or tee installation can create the same problem.
Water hammer can normally be cured by mounting fittings called air chambers or shock absorbers in the plumbing to which the problem shutoffs or faucets are attached. These devices permit the shock wave produced by the halted circulation of water to dissipate in the air they have, which (unlike water) is compressible.
Older plumbing systems may have brief vertical areas of capped pipeline behind walls on faucet competes the very same purpose; these can ultimately loaded with water, decreasing or ruining their performance. The cure is to drain the water supply entirely by shutting off the main water system shutoff and also opening up all taps. After that open the major supply valve and shut the faucets one by one, starting with the tap nearest the valve and ending with the one farthest away.
Chattering or Shrieking
Intense chattering or screeching that takes place when a shutoff or tap is activated, and that typically disappears when the fitting is opened totally, signals loosened or faulty internal components. The remedy is to replace the valve or tap with a new one.
Pumps and devices such as washing equipments as well as dishwashing machines can move motor sound to pipes if they are improperly linked. Link such products to plumbing with plastic or rubber hoses-never inflexible pipe-to isolate them.
Other Inlet Side Noises
Squeaking, squeaking, scraping, breaking, as well as touching typically are triggered by the growth or contraction of pipes, typically copper ones supplying warm water. The sounds take place as the pipelines slide against loosened bolts or strike nearby home framework. You can typically determine the location of the trouble if the pipes are subjected; just follow the audio when the pipes are making noise. Most likely you will certainly find a loose pipe hanger or a location where pipelines exist so near to flooring joists or other framing pieces that they clatter versus them. Affixing foam pipeline insulation around the pipes at the point of contact should remedy the trouble. Make sure straps and wall mounts are safe and provide ample support. Where feasible, pipeline fasteners must be connected to enormous architectural aspects such as foundation walls as opposed to to framing; doing so lessens the transmission of vibrations from plumbing to surface areas that can amplify and also transfer them. If attaching bolts to framing is inescapable, wrap pipelines with insulation or other resistant material where they speak to fasteners, and also sandwich the ends of brand-new fasteners between rubber washing machines when installing them.
Dealing with plumbing runs that experience flow-restricting limited or countless bends is a last resource that ought to be embarked on only after getting in touch with an experienced plumbing specialist. Regrettably, this scenario is relatively usual in older homes that might not have actually been developed with indoor plumbing or that have actually seen several remodels, specifically by novices.
Drain Noise
On the drainpipe side of plumbing, the chief goals are to remove surfaces that can be struck by dropping or hurrying water and to protect pipelines to include inescapable sounds.
In new building and construction, bathtubs, shower stalls, bathrooms, as well as wallmounted sinks and also basins ought to be set on or against durable underlayments to lower the transmission of audio through them. Water-saving toilets and faucets are less noisy than traditional designs; install them instead of older kinds even if codes in your area still permit utilizing older fixtures.
Drains that do not run vertically to the cellar or that branch into straight pipe runs sustained at floor joists or various other mounting present specifically bothersome sound problems. Such pipelines are big sufficient to emit significant vibration; they additionally lug significant quantities of water, which makes the situation even worse. In brand-new building, define cast-iron dirt pipes (the huge pipelines that drain commodes) if you can afford them. Their enormity consists of much of the sound made by water passing through them. Additionally, avoid transmitting drainpipes in walls shown to bedrooms and also rooms where people collect. Walls consisting of drains should be soundproofed as was explained previously, using double panels of sound-insulating fiberboard and also wallboard. Pipelines themselves can be wrapped with special fiberglass insulation produced the function; such pipelines have a resistant plastic skin (sometimes including lead). 3 Most Common Reasons for Noisy Water Pipes
Water hammer
When water is running and is then suddenly turned off, the rushing liquid has no place to go and slams against the shut-off valve. The loud, thudding sound that follows is known as a water hammer. Besides being alarming, water hammer can potentially damage joints and connections in the water pipe itself. There are two primary methods of addressing this issue.
Check your air chamber. An air chamber is essentially a vertical pipe located near your faucet, often in the wall cavity that holds the plumbing connected to your sink or tub. The chamber is filled with air that compresses and absorbs the shock of the fast moving water when it suddenly stops. Unfortunately, over time air chambers tend to fill with water and lose their effectiveness. To replenish the air chambers in your house you can do the following. Turn off the water supply to your house at the main supply (or street level). Open your faucets to drain all of the water from your plumbing system. Turn the water back on. The incoming water will flush the air out of the pipes but not out of the vertical air chamber, where the air supply has been restored. Copper pipes
Copper pipes tend to expand as hot water passes through and transfers some of its heat to them. (Copper is both malleable and ductile.) In tight quarters, copper hot-water lines can expand and then noisily rub against your home's hidden structural features — studs, joists, support brackets, etc. — as it contracts.
One possible solution to this problem is to slightly lower the temperature setting on your hot water heater. In all but the most extreme cases, expanding and contracting copper pipes will not spring a leak. Unless you’re remodeling, there's no reason to remove sheetrock and insert foam padding around your copper pipes.
Water pressure that’s too high
If your water pressure is too high, it can also cause noisy water pipes. Worse, high water pressure can damage water-supplied appliances, such as your washing machine and dishwasher.
Most modern homes are equipped with a pressure regulator that's mounted where the water supply enters the house. If your home lacks a regulator, consider having one professionally installed. Finally, remember that most plumbers recommend that water is delivered throughout your home at no lower than 40 and no greater than 80 psi (pounds per square inch).
